Shi’ism is a book that I had to read for my Islam class the semester. It is about the sect of Islam that believes in not only God as God and Muhammad as his prophet, but also that Ali (who was the son-in-law of Muhammad) was the rightful heir to Muhammad’s leadership when he passed away. They believe that Ali was chosen to carry on the teachings of the Koran, this is the division between the two sects. The Shi’ites are considered to be very fundamental in their beliefs. Although Ali and those who followed him believed that he was the rightful heir to everything that Muhammad left behind, there were many people who contested this belief and therefore he was forced to fight to stay in power. He waged many wars and because of this the Muslim world was thrown into turmoil for a while. It is interesting the there was no contention for someone to take over Jesus’ place when he was crucified. Yes, there were missionaries that went out and continued to share message that he preached, however there was no one who actually wanted to take Jesus’ place.
